description Product Description

1-Benzyl-3-bromobenzene is primarily used as an intermediate in organic synthesis, particularly in the production of pharmaceuticals and agrochemicals. Its structure allows it to participate in various chemical reactions, such as cross-coupling reactions, which are essential for creating complex organic molecules. It is also utilized in the development of liquid crystals and other advanced materials due to its aromatic and halogenated properties. Additionally, it serves as a building block in the synthesis of dyes and pigments, contributing to the coloration of various industrial products.
